"I recently stayed at Hotel Adler in Rudolstadt and was impressed by its unbeatable location—right in the city center, just steps from the main square, the train station, and the stunning baroque Heidecksburg Castle. The hotel is housed in a beautiful historic building dating back to 1880, which adds a lot of character and charm to the experience.
The rooms are spacious, cozy, and tastefully decorated, reflecting the style of the period while still offering modern comfort. There is parking available, which is a great convenience if you’re traveling by car.
One downside is that the rooms are not air-conditioned, which can be a bit uncomfortable in hot weather. However, given the age and style of the building, it’s understandable and didn’t detract too much from the overall experience.
The staff is friendly, though they speak only German, which might be a bit challenging for non-German speakers. As for breakfast, it’s fairly basic—not outstanding, but perfectly adequate to start the day.
Overall, Hotel Adler is a great choice if you’re looking to stay somewhere with character and a central location in Rudolstadt."

What’s there to see and do in Neuhaus am Rennweg?
While you're exploring the area, Saalfeld Fairy Grottoes and Thuringian Forest Nature Park are a couple of picturesque spots to get outside and enjoy nature. In the wider area, you’ll find Burg Lauenstein and Rosenau Palace.
